We have setup custom domain for our App Engine app (std env) and it is 
working fine for HTTPS for most of the modern browsers.

But there is a problem with old TLS1.0 clients that do not support SNI 
(Server Name Indication). Since the custom domain is a CNAME to 
ghs.googlehosted.com clients need SNI to get to correct app on app engine. 

Is there any alternative way of setting custom domain for HTTPS that does 
not involve ghs.googlehosted.com or SNI? Any suggestions for a LB, CDN, 
Proxy that can serve dedicated custom domain talking to app engine app 
(over http/https) as backend?
